Clutch Slave Cylinder on the 2012 Ford Ranger: What You Need to Know
The 2012 Ford Ranger is a popular ute in Australia, known for its toughness and reliability, especially in work and off-road environments. Understanding the components that keep it running smoothly, like the clutch system, is important for any owner. One part often discussed when it comes to the clutch assembly is the clutch slave cylinder. So, does the 2012 Ford Ranger use a clutch slave cylinder? And if it does, what exactly does this part do, and how should it be maintained? Let's dive into this.
First up, the 2012 Ford Ranger is equipped with a hydraulic clutch system. This means that when the driver presses the clutch pedal, a fluid-powered system transfers this force to disengage the clutch. Integral to this hydraulic system is the clutch slave cylinder. If you imagine the clutch assembly as a team working together, the clutch master cylinder is the player who starts the action by pushing hydraulic fluid, and the clutch slave cylinder is the player who receives this force and physically moves the clutch release mechanism.
The clutch slave cylinder is usually mounted on the transmission housing and is connected to the clutch fork or directly to the release bearing, depending on the specific design. When the driver presses the clutch pedal, the master cylinder generates hydraulic pressure sent through the fluid lines to the slave cylinder. The slave cylinder then uses this pressure to move its piston, which in turn pushes the clutch fork and disengages the clutch from the flywheel, allowing smooth gear changes.
This hydraulic setup, including the clutch slave cylinder, replaces the older mechanical linkage or cable systems that were once common. The hydraulic system provides smoother clutch operation, requires less pedal effort, and can self-adjust to a certain extent as components wear, delivering a better driving experience over time.
When it comes to the 2012 Ford Ranger's clutch slave cylinder, being aware of its role is useful for maintenance and longevity. Like all hydraulic components, the clutch slave cylinder relies on proper hydraulic fluid and sealing to operate efficiently. A failing slave cylinder can cause clutch pedal problems - such as a soft or sinking pedal, difficulty disengaging the clutch, or in some cases, fluid leaks around the transmission.
Regular maintenance usually includes checking the clutch fluid reservoir (which holds the hydraulic fluid shared by the master and slave cylinders), topping it up with the correct fluid, and looking out for any leaks or contamination. Over time, the seals inside the slave cylinder can wear out or get damaged, leading to a loss of hydraulic pressure and clutch function issues.
If a clutch slave cylinder needs replacing on a 2012 Ford Ranger, it's generally a straightforward repair but does require some mechanical know-how or the help of a trusted mechanic. It involves:
- Locating the slave cylinder on the transmission housing
- Removing the hydraulic lines carefully to avoid fluid loss or air entering the system
- Removing the mounting bolts and replacing the faulty cylinder with a new part
- Bleeding the clutch hydraulic system thoroughly to remove any trapped air, which can cause spongy clutch pedal feel or incomplete disengagement
Bleeding the system is a crucial step and can be done by pumping the clutch pedal while opening and closing the bleed valve on the slave cylinder until only clean fluid appears and no air bubbles remain. Neglecting to bleed the system properly can leave a driver with poor clutch feel or even difficulty in changing gears.
Another thing to keep in mind is to use only the correct type of hydraulic fluid specified in the owner's manual, usually DOT 3 or DOT 4 brake fluid. Using the wrong fluid can damage seals inside the clutch hydraulic components, leading to premature failure.
Watching for symptoms of clutch slave cylinder wear is part of good vehicle care. Common warning signs include:
- Clutch pedal feels soft or goes to the floor with little resistance
- Difficulty shifting gears, particularly into reverse or first gear
- Visible fluid leaks under the vehicle, especially near the transmission
- Clutch pedal sticks or does not return properly
- Unusual noises when pressing the clutch pedal
If any of these issues arise, it is wise to have the clutch hydraulic system inspected promptly. Early detection and replacement of the slave cylinder can prevent being stranded and avoid damage to other clutch components.
In short, the clutch slave cylinder plays a key role in the 2012 Ford Ranger's clutch system by converting hydraulic pressure into the mechanical action needed to disengage the clutch. Keeping an eye on this part, maintaining hydraulic fluid levels, and ensuring the system is free from leaks will help keep the clutch working smoothly and prevent costly repairs down the track.
